Output 2ac8406d5c127de31241fc9591cd1d681784c4398b472ab520bdcfb3cfb7203a:0

value
663773532
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b881fe23ee2d2ca349b263fb7f0e0018727365d3 OP_EQUALVERIFY OP_CHECKSIG
address
1Hpb4MKp8rPhXfMzhyc1HYDNSKtKG5JKed
transaction
2ac8406d5c127de31241fc9591cd1d681784c4398b472ab520bdcfb3cfb7203a
spent
true